How a Cryptocurrency Wallet Works: An In-Depth Look
In the digital age, cryptocurrencies have emerged as one of the most significant financial innovations, offering users a new way to conduct transactions without relying on traditional banking systems. At the heart of this revolution is the cryptocurrency wallet—a critical component that enables individuals and businesses to securely store, send, receive, and spend their digital assets. Understanding how a cryptocurrency wallet works not only provides insight into the technology behind these cryptocurrencies but also helps in making informed decisions about privacy, security, and convenience when managing your digital wealth.
The Basics of Cryptocurrency Wallets
A cryptocurrency wallet is essentially a digital container for holding cryptocurrencies. It serves as an interface between the user and the blockchain—a public ledger that records all transactions across a cryptocurrency network. There are two main types of wallets: software wallets and hardware wallets, each with its unique advantages and security features.
Software Wallets
Software wallets are digital applications installed on various devices such as computers, smartphones, or tablets. They can be categorized into hot wallets and cold wallets based on their storage method. Hot wallets store cryptocurrencies on the user's device but connect to a server for real-time access. This ease of connectivity comes with risks, as users need to log in and connect to servers that could potentially become targets for hackers. Cold wallets, conversely, keep private keys offline, offering higher security but requiring more effort to conduct transactions since they require direct connections or internet searches to find addresses.
Hardware Wallets
Hardware wallets are physical devices designed for secure cryptocurrency storage. Unlike software wallets, hardware wallets do not connect to the internet and store keys locally, eliminating the risk of online hacking attempts. This offline approach ensures that no one can access cryptocurrencies without having physical control over the device itself. Examples include Trezor, Ledger, and ColdCard.
How a Cryptocurrency Wallet Functionalizes Transactions
The process of transacting in cryptocurrencies involves several key steps, which are facilitated by cryptocurrency wallets. Here's how it works:
1. Generating Private/Public Key Pair: Each wallet contains a unique pair of private and public keys that control access to the cryptocurrency stored within. The private key must be kept secret to prevent unauthorized transactions; in contrast, the public key can be shared for receiving funds or linking a wallet to a blockchain account.
2. Sending Cryptocurrency: When a user wants to send cryptocurrencies, they create a transaction. This involves specifying the amount of cryptocurrency being sent and the recipient's public address (derived from their public key). The wallet also generates a new transaction record or signature that is encrypted with the sender's private key and signed by the sender's public key.
3. Confirmation: The transaction then gets broadcasted to the blockchain network, which nodes verify its authenticity by confirming that: 1) the sender has sufficient funds in their wallet; 2) the address of the recipient is correct; 3) the data within the transaction matches the cryptographic signature. If all checks pass, miners add this transaction to a block and it becomes part of the blockchain, effectively completing the transfer of cryptocurrencies from one wallet to another.
4. Receiving Cryptocurrency: When someone sends cryptocurrency to your wallet's public address, you receive a notification that includes information about the transaction, including the amount sent and the originating wallet or user (if known). The transaction is then added to the blockchain, which your wallet can access locally for viewing and processing if necessary.
Security Considerations in Cryptocurrency Wallets
Security is paramount when it comes to cryptocurrency wallets. Here are some key security considerations:
Backup: Regularly backing up your private keys ensures that you can recover your cryptocurrencies even if something goes wrong with the wallet device or software.
Physical Access Controls: For hardware wallets, physical access controls are crucial; a lost or stolen device means loss of funds without exception.
Password Protection and Biometric Authentication: Software wallets often require password protection and biometric authentication to secure access to the wallet's contents.
Avoid Public Computers: Using your cryptocurrency wallet on public computers can expose your private keys to malware or eavesdropping.
Conclusion: Navigating the Cryptocurrency Wallet Landscape
Understanding how a cryptocurrency wallet works provides a foundational understanding of navigating this landscape. From choosing between software and hardware wallets, considering security measures, to managing privacy concerns, every decision made in the context of cryptocurrency wallets has significant implications for both individual users and institutions looking to engage with this burgeoning technology. As the world continues to evolve towards a more digitized economy, mastering the intricacies of cryptocurrency wallets will be key to participating fully in this transformative financial revolution.